Asymptotic field formulations, MUSIC-type retrievals of small 3-D bounded dielectric and/or magnetic inclusions, and their application to dipole source and receiver arrays

Abstract

The identification of a collection of small 3-D bounded homogeneous inclusions, with arbitrary permittivity, conductivity and permeability, buried within a homogeneous or stratified medium is considered via time-harmonic electromagnetic means. The applications envisaged are in environment, civil and military engineering, non- destructive testing of man-made structures, medical imaging, etc. Specific attention at the present stage is given to configurations possibly met in the identification of small objects within Earth subsoils. The proposed approach uses Music-type algorithms, and enables us to achieve fast numbering, accurate localization, and in the best case (so-called well-separated inclusions) estimates of the electromagnetic and geometric parameters of the inclusions.
